Twitter adds Ethereum support to its virtual 'tipping' feature, months after adding bitcoin support.

Twitter TWTR, -2.00 percent announced on Wednesday that it is expanding its mobile tipping feature to include support for Ethereum, 0.42 percent.

Twitter's "Tips" service allows users to send money, including cryptocurrency, to accounts they like via the Twitter mobile app. In September 2021, the social media behemoth began accepting bitcoin, -0.05% tips.

"We're continuing to expand ways to get paid on Twitter, including more options for creators and fans who want to use crypto," said Johnny Winston, Twitter's lead product manager of creator monetisation, in a statement. "We're thrilled to allow anyone to add their ETH Address to Tips."

It should be noted that it is unclear whether Twitter Tips will support other Ethereum blockchain tokens, such as ERC-20 tokens and stablecoins, or only ether.

Twitter's announcement demonstrates the company's interest in cryptocurrency and blockchain technology. On Thursday, Twitter began allowing some users to use their non-fungible tokens, or NFTs, as profile pictures, which they began doing earlier this year. (A non-fungible token (NFT) is a certificate of ownership for a one-of-a-kind digital asset that is not intended to be exchanged.)
